The Punjab School Education Board (PSEB) has officially announced the supplementary exam dates for Class 10 and 12 students who could not pass one or more subjects in the regular board exams. The PSEB Supplementary Exams 2025 are scheduled to begin from August 8, 2025, and will be conducted across various exam centers in the state.

Students can download their PSEB supplementary exam admit cards from the board's official website pseb.ac.in by entering their roll number and date of birth. The detailed date sheet and subject-wise exam schedule have also been published on the portal.
The exams will be held in offline mode across designated centers in Punjab. Candidates are advised to carry their admit card, valid ID proof, and follow all examination guidelines issued by the board.
These supplementary exams offer a second chance for students to improve their scores and secure admission to higher education programs. Schools have been instructed to ensure that students are well-informed about exam dates and venue details.

Who Can Appear?
Students of Class 10 and 12 who received compartment/fail status in one or more subjects in the main exams are eligible.
Candidates must have filled out the supplementary exam application form within the prescribed deadline to appear.

Evaluation for supplementary papers will be completed by late August, and results are expected to be declared by mid-September 2025.
